I nostri antenati is the name of italo calvino s heraldic trilogy that comprises the cloven viscount 1952, the baron in the trees 1957, and the nonexistent knight 1959. The three were all written at separate times and can stand alone as stories, having no concrete link with each other, apart from calvino s writing style.
